Enter the "Cthulhu is Your Friend" contest!

In anticipation of the Old Ones eventual arrival, Game Trade Magazine is holding a "Cthulhu is Your Friend" contest. Draw an image of Cthulhu and send it in for your chance to win a signed copy of the Call of Cthulhu RPG. The Game Trade Magazine staff will choose the winner from all entries.

All entries must be received by Dec. 13th, 2002.
